Physical Education Schools in Illinois
In 2022-2023, 257 students earned their Physical Education degrees in IL.
As a degree choice, Physical Education is the 135th most popular major in the state.
Education Levels of Physical Education Majors in Illinois
Physical Education maj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:
| Education Level | Number of Grads |
|---|---|
| Master’s Degree | 126 |
| Bachelor’s Degree | 98 |
| Award Taking Less Than 1 Year | 30 |
| Associate Degree | 3 |
Gender Distribution
In Illinois, a physical education major is more popular with men than with women.
Racial Distribution
The racial distribution of physical education majors in Illinois is as follows:
- Asian: 2.7%
- Black or African American: 12.1%
- Hispanic or Latino: 16.0%
- White: 51.8%
- Non-Resident Alien: 5.8%
- Other Races: 11.7%
Jobs for Physical Education Grads in Illinois
In this state, there are 28,220 people employed in jobs related to a physical education degree, compared to 572,730 nationwide.
Wages for Physical Education Jobs in Illinois
Physical Education grads earn an average of $46,670 in the state and $44,580 nationwide.
